About Knowle

Knowle is a vibrant district and council ward located in south-east Bristol, approximately 2 miles from the city centre. Nestled along the broad ridge of the Wells Road, it is flanked by Filwood Park, Brislington, Whitchurch, Hengrove, and Totterdown. The name Knowle, recorded as Canole in the Domesday Book of 1086, originates from the Old English term for 'hill,' highlighting the area's distinctive topography that descends towards the River Avon. Planning Activity in Knowle

In the last 24 months, 85 planning applications were submitted near Knowle. Of these, 65% were approved, with an average decision time of 61 days.

This is below the national average of approximately 87%, which may reflect stricter local policies, sensitivity of the area, or higher levels of speculative applications. Pre-application advice is particularly worthwhile near Knowle.

At 61 days on average, decisions near Knowle slightly exceed the 8-week statutory target for minor applications, though this is common across many councils.

The most common application types near Knowle were full planning applications (36), outline applications (17), discharge of conditions (8). Full planning applications account for 42% of all submissions, covering new builds, change of use, and works that go beyond permitted development rights.

In terms of development scale, 1 large-scale (major) development, 1 medium-scale application, 72 smaller schemes were submitted.
